Alexandra M. Johnstone is a scholar working on Physiology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Alexandra M. Johnstone has authored 135 papers receiving a total of 9.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 82 papers in Physiology, 68 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 23 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in Alexandra M. Johnstone’s work include Diet and metabolism studies (60 papers),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(43 papers) and Nutritional Studies and Diet (33 papers). Alexandra M. Johnstone is often cited by papers focused on Diet and metabolism studies (60 papers),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(43 papers) and Nutritional Studies and Diet (33 papers). Alexandra M. Johnstone coll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Ireland and The Netherlands. Alexandra M. Johnstone's co-authors include Grietje Holtrop, Harry J. Flint, Sylvia H. Duncan, G. E. Lobley, R. James Stubbs, Graham Horgan, Jennifer Ince, Petra Louis, John R. Speakman and K. A. Rance and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, NeuroImage and American Journal of Clinical Nutrition.
